Randy Bush wrote: > > >> cvsupped a complete source and ports trees > >> > >> *default host=cvsup7.freebsd.org > >> *default base=/usr > >> *default prefix=/usr > >> *default release=cvs > >> *default delete use-rel-suffix > >> *default tag=RELENG_4 > >> src-all > >> doc-all > >> *default tag=. > >> ports-all > > > > The second '*default tag=" is overriding the first, so you're actually > > cvsup'ing -CURRENT. > > i believe that the file is executed sequentially in a programmatic fashion. > hence only ports is using the . tag. The doc-all also belongs after the tag=.. I also don't mix my cvsup files for docs, ports, and userland. I have built my world several times over the last couple of days without any problems. When your buildworld fails, did you recvsup to get the latest code. That is very important.
